Wireless Remote Monitoring – DPharm Podcast Series #2

DPharm podcast series # 2 MIT Professor, Dina Katabi, PhD gave one of the best talks on in home non-intrusive patient monitoring at DPharm 2017 and provided a demo of technology that uses ambient radio signals to monitor a patient’s gait, falls, breathing, heart rate and even sleep, all without putting any sensor on the patient’s body. Find out how they have used the technology to redefine clinical endpoints and pushed clinical trials to the home. The next DPharm conference is September 25-26 in Boston.
